
Quad, 12-bit digital-to-analog converter (DAC) featuring a 25MS/s conversion rate and 12-bit resolution. This unipolar voltage output DAC offers a 5.5V maximum output voltage and a 90dB signal-to-noise ratio. The device includes a 2 ppm/°C on-chip reference and operates via an SPI interface. Housed in a TSSOP package with tin, matte contact plating, it supports a wide operating temperature range of -40°C to 105°C.
Analog Devices AD5684RBCPZ-RL7 technical specifications.
| Package/Case | TSSOP |
| Contact Plating | Tin, Matte |
| Conversion Rate | 25MS/s |
| Differential Output | No |
| Integral Nonlinearity (INL) | 1LSB |
| Interface | SPI |
| Lead Free | Contains Lead |
| Max Operating Temperature | 105°C |
| Min Operating Temperature | -40°C |
| Max Output Voltage | 5.5V |
| Min Output Voltage | 2.5V |
| Max Supply Voltage | 5.5V |
| Min Supply Voltage | 2.7V |
| Number of Bits | 12 |
| Number of Converters | 4 |
| Number of D/A Converters | 4 |
| Number of DAC Channels | 4 |
| Output Polarity | Unipolar |
| Output Type | Voltage |
| Package Quantity | 1500 |
| Packaging | Tape and Reel |
| Power Dissipation | 7.2mW |
| Reach SVHC Compliant | No |
| Resolution | 12b |
| RoHS Compliant | Yes |
| Sampling Rate | 25MS/s |
| Series | nanoDAC+® |
| Settling Time | 5us |
| Signal to Noise Ratio (SNR) | 90dB |
| Slew Rate | 0.8V/µs |
| RoHS | Compliant |
